Visitor Policy

Interview with Todd

JM: How often could you receive visitors?
Todd: It was every weekend. They give you a list of visitation and whoever is on that list can come. You have to request who you want to visit you with their names, phone numbers, ages, etc. Then you have to let your visitors know that they are on the list.

JM: Was the check-in process lengthy for those who came to see you?
Todd: No, not as long as you are not a convicted felon. If you have been convicted of a felony you have to wait six months before you can visit anyone.

JM: What was the visiting environment like?
Todd: A stool, a steel table, a glass wall between inmate and visitor. You talk through the glass with no phone.
